Streamlining Sustainability Planning for Continuous Progress

Sustainable development requires a dynamic and adaptable approach. Businesses must shift from static sustainability plans to frameworks that actively cultivate continuous improvement. This involves periodically evaluating performance against goals, identifying areas for upgrade, and integrating innovative strategies. By embracing a culture of continuous improvement, players can ensure their sustainability efforts remain relevant, effective, and contribute to long-term progress.

Boosting Sustainability Processes Through Iterative Planning

Iterative planning plays a crucial role in optimizing sustainability processes. By adopting an iterative approach, organizations can consistently assess their strategies, recognize areas for enhancement, and implement changes accordingly. This dynamic model allows for adjustment throughout the sustainability journey, ensuring that goals are achieved in a responsible manner.

Adopting an iterative planning process can yield numerous benefits for organizations. It promotes accountability by involving stakeholders at each stage of the journey. This fosters a sense of ownership and promotes collaboration, leading to more effective sustainability outcomes. Furthermore, iterative planning allows organizations to adjust to shifting circumstances and incorporate emerging best practices into their environmental efforts.

Harmonizing Sustainability and Operational Excellence: Strategic Planning

Achieving a balance between environmental responsibility and operational excellence requires a deliberate and strategic approach. Organizations must integrate sustainability considerations into their core operations, fostering a culture of conscious decision-making. This involves developing comprehensive roadmaps that synchronize business objectives with sustainable practices. By utilizing data and analytics, organizations can monitor their progress toward sustainability targets and identify areas for improvement. Through continuous assessment, companies can adjust their strategies to ensure they remain effective in achieving both operational excellence and long-term societal impact.

  • Prioritize key sustainability metrics that measure the organization's impact.
  • Establish clear targets and deadlines for achieving sustainability goals.
  • Engage with stakeholders, including employees, suppliers, and customers, to foster a shared commitment to sustainability.

Evaluating and Optimizing Sustainability Performance: A Planning Framework

Establishing a robust framework for measuring and improving sustainability performance is crucial for organizations committed to responsible growth. This framework should encompass a comprehensive set of indicators that align with key sustainability goals, such as environmental protection, social responsibility, and economic viability. Regular monitoring and evaluation of these indicators allow organizations to recognize areas for improvement and track their progress over time. A well-defined action plan, guided by data insights, can then be implemented to address identified gaps and foster a culture of sustainability within the organization.

  • Comprehensive planning is essential for setting clear sustainability objectives and aligning them with overall business goals.
  • Collaboration across departments and with external stakeholders is key to ensuring buy-in and effective implementation of sustainability initiatives.
  • Openness in reporting on sustainability performance builds trust and encourages continuous improvement.
